Output e8828be04d21b32fa8f2f5e62ae7fcf81ca39bce0ffb7c8a5170fa8d2631ad64:0

value
5017897
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8b458ae05199397ca46d0fffd9e1b11884bd972 OP_EQUAL
address
3JXeJXc2kP1dcXnwTanD2hqKCvMSSyvM6X
transaction
e8828be04d21b32fa8f2f5e62ae7fcf81ca39bce0ffb7c8a5170fa8d2631ad64
confirmations
110135
spent
true